Solar across Hampshire

Hampshire spans coastal cities, the South Downs, the New Forest fringe and a strong commuter belt around Basingstoke, Winchester and Fleet. Solar performs exceptionally well across the county — south-coast irradiance is amongst the highest in mainland Britain, and the housing mix offers excellent roof real estate. Demand has grown sharply since 2022 across all eight Hampshire districts.

Why now

Why solar makes sense in Hampshire

  • Southern Hampshire (Portsmouth, Southampton, Fareham) records 1,050-1,150 kWh/kWp annually — top-tier UK performance.

  • Hampshire homes have a higher-than-average EV ownership rate; combining solar, battery and a tariff like Octopus Intelligent Go reliably gives 4-7 year payback on the battery alone.

  • Many properties in the New Forest, South Downs National Park and Winchester conservation areas require sensitive design — our vetted partners include heritage specialists.

  • ECO4-funded installs are available for eligible lower-income Hampshire households on means-tested benefits.

Hampshire market notes

Coastal salt-air exposure makes corrosion-rated mounting hardware important along the Solent. Inland, the standard A2 stainless mounting kits are fine. Installer lead times across Hampshire run 4-8 weeks outside peak season.

Typical property mix

A balanced mix of detached, semi-detached and terraced housing, with substantial new-build estates around Whiteley, Andover, Basingstoke and Eastleigh — many already pre-wired or configured for solar. Bungalows are common in coastal districts and ideal for solar.

Grants, VAT & export

0% VAT applies. The Smart Export Guarantee pays for export. ECO4 grants can cover most or all of an install for qualifying low-income households. Some New Forest and South Downs parish councils have small community-energy grant pools.

FAQs

Common Hampshire solar questions

What size solar system suits a typical Hampshire home?

A 4-6 kWp system is most common, covering 60-90% of an average household's electricity needs across the year. Larger family homes typically opt for 6-10 kWp with a battery.

Do coastal Hampshire homes need different solar equipment?

Yes — we specify A4 or duplex stainless mounting components and IP-rated isolators for properties within roughly 5 km of the coast to mitigate salt corrosion.

How long does solar installation take in Hampshire?

A standard residential install runs 1-2 days on the roof, plus 1 day for the inverter, battery and commissioning. Scaffolding goes up a day or two beforehand.

What return can I expect in Hampshire?

Most Hampshire homes see 9-13% annual ROI from a solar + battery system at current electricity prices — well ahead of cash savings or most ISA products.
